ASD is worth the money

They finally got notifications to work which was a problem. I’m sure all the answering service people are great and sweet but the app is horrible. There’s no transcript, no way to listen to first call messages, more than half the time information is wrong, they will have it listed as church is calling when it’s really cemetery and have limited notes so you barley know what you’re calling back for it makes us look unprofessional. If they aren’t going to give better in depth notes they need to give us the ability to listen to the calls ourselves or at least have a transcript so we can be prepared before calling. The app itself is not visually appealing for one but also unorganized. Sorry but the extra pretty penny is worth it to spend on ASD if you care about your business and professionalism. I’d rather take all the calls myself at this point than having to stress out because we never get accurate or all the needed information.

Notification Issues on iOS 18.1.1

Dear Dev Team,

Many users, including myself, are experiencing issues with notifications in the app while running the latest iOS version (18.1.1).

Here’s a potential approach to help diagnose and resolve the issue:
•Use your development tools to emulate both a working and broken version of notifications
•Enable debugging and compare the logs. I’ve noticed issues on devices with iPhone 16 architecture, which might provide a clue.

Additionally, I’ve observed the following behavior that might be helpful in identifying the problem:
•Manually disabling notifications in the iOS settings does not trigger any prompt within the app to re-enable them.
•Even after navigating to the app’s notification settings, there’s no indication or guidance to restore notifications, suggesting there might be an issue with how notifications are implemented.

I hope this information is helpful.
